Вопросы по теме 'thrift'
Отслеживание связей с Thrift
Я пытаюсь создать игру с помощью Thrift, чтобы клиенты были игроками, а сервер управлял досками, как это . Однако я не могу понять, как сервер Facebook Thrift может «отследить» пользователя, то есть при вызове attack() на их услуги , мне не нужно...
686 просмотров
schedule
24.04.2024
Использование oneway void в определениях функций Thrift
Я использую модификатор oneway в одном из определений функции Thrift:
...
oneway void secret_function(1: string x, 2: string y),
...
При генерации соответствующего кода Erlang через Thrift это преобразуется в:
......
1691 просмотров
schedule
05.04.2022
По каким причинам использование Thrift API для доступа к Cassandra нежелательно?
Пожалуйста, перечислите причины, почему не рекомендуется использовать интерфейс Thrift для Cassandra? Каковы возможные преимущества и недостатки?
456 просмотров
schedule
25.06.2022
Бережливое определение функций сервера
Я хотел бы, чтобы клиент подключался к серверу и определял, какие функции принимает процесс с параметрами и возвращаемыми типами.
Я уже могу подключиться к службе и
Язык, на котором я хотел бы это сделать, — C++.
Предоставляет ли Thrift API...
200 просмотров
schedule
22.01.2023
Проверяет ли Apache Thrif параметры?
Я рассматриваю возможность использования Apache Thrift для PHP-сервера, реализующего веб-сервисы.
Если бы моя веб-служба была определена так, чтобы принимать два параметра — имя пользователя в виде строки и пароль в виде целого числа, — я бы...
1997 просмотров
schedule
07.05.2024
Прокручивайте определенные файлы ресурсов в maven для создания источников
Я использую maven-antrun-plugin для генерации исходников из thrift IDL.
У меня есть отдельный проект (и jar) для хранения этих сгенерированных источников, и этот плагин не поддерживает замену подстановочных знаков, поэтому я не могу сказать...
1190 просмотров
schedule
10.04.2024
Как начать работу с Apache Thrift?
Я хотел создать простой сервер Thrift для C++ и предоставить клиенту язык Python. Я зашел на официальный сайт, но там нет хороших руководств или документации. Мне трудно попробовать это.
Есть ли хороший учебник по Apache Thrift для совершенно...
20005 просмотров
schedule
12.01.2024
Python Thrift RPC не работает на EC2
Я пытаюсь создать простое клиент-серверное приложение с использованием Thrift, которое будет работать на EC2.
Созданный мной пример отлично работает для localhost, но когда я пытаюсь выполнить вызов RPC на двух разных машинах на ec2 (обе из которых...
877 просмотров
schedule
08.11.2023
Разница между Apache Thrift и ZeroMQ
Я понимаю, что Apache Thrift и ZeroMQ — это программы, принадлежащие к разным категориям, и сравнивать их непросто, поскольку это сравнение яблока с апельсином. Но я не знаю, почему они относятся к разным категориям. Разве они оба не используются...
10945 просмотров
schedule
21.04.2022
Неблокирующий Thrift Server на C++ и Thrift Client на Python
У меня есть неблокирующий многопоточный сберегательный сервер, написанный на C++, и сберегательный клиент, написанный на python. В приведенных ниже фрагментах кода кратко показано, как протокол бережливости и конфигурации привязки выполняются как на...
5679 просмотров
schedule
17.04.2024
создание пространства ключей
Я пытаюсь получить доступ к cassandra из erlang, в качестве теста я пытаюсь создать новое пространство ключей. Я делаю это следующим образом:
1> rr(cassandra_thrift).
[authenticationException,authenticationRequest,...
200 просмотров
schedule
07.09.2022
Как я могу использовать специфичные для Java типы в службе Thrift?
Я пишу службу Thrift, основная функция которой заключается в передаче всех запросов к EJB Beans. По сути, служба получает вызов, ищет локальный компонент, перенаправляет запрос компоненту и пересылает ответ обратно клиенту.
Основная проблема...
342 просмотров
schedule
09.12.2022
Ошибки компиляции Java-классов, сгенерированных Apache Thrift, которые реализуют абстрактный класс.
Моя группа пытается создать сервер с использованием Apache Thrift, но у нас возникают странные проблемы с компиляцией. В сгенерированных файлах Java из Thrift присутствуют следующие строки:
public static class Client extends...
3375 просмотров
schedule
09.06.2022
Словарь Python со списком, как описать его в коде-заглушке?
Я пытаюсь отправить словарь Python {"1": ["2", 3, 4]} . Сервер и клиент как здесь , используются только TSocket.TServerSocket(unix_socket="socket") и TSocket.TSocket(unix_socket="socket") соответственно. Функция возвращает словарь с именем...
2219 просмотров
schedule
13.04.2023
Сервер бережливости HDFS возвращает содержимое локальной ФС, а не HDFS
Я получаю доступ к HDFS, используя бережливость.
Это ожидаемый (и правильный) контент на HDFS.
[hadoop@hdp-namenode-01 ~]$ hadoop fs -ls /
Found 3 items
drwxr-xr-x - hadoop supergroup 0 2012-04-26 14:07 /home
drwxr-xr-x - hadoop...
899 просмотров
schedule
30.05.2024
Как запустить сервер Ruby Thrift в продакшене?
Мне нужно реализовать Thrift API с использованием Ruby.
Каковы мои варианты запуска сервера в производстве?
Какой лучший вариант?
В настоящее время я просто создаю экземпляр SimpleServer и вызываю на нем #serve. Это, очевидно, дерьмовое...
1866 просмотров
schedule
10.10.2023
Сжатие при сериализации
Я сериализовал файл размером 116 КБ в экономичный двоичный формат, используя компактный протокол, но даже после сериализации размер составляет 116 КБ. Разве сериализатор не должен уменьшать размер файла? Файл содержит только строки, если эта...
167 просмотров
schedule
16.10.2022
Как отключить аутентификацию WSO2 BAM Thrift
Можно ли отключить экономную аутентификацию WSO2 BAM? Мы публикуем BAM на хосте, отличном от «localhost», и получаем следующую ошибку.
507672 [pool-7-thread-30] ERROR org.wso2.carbon.bam.agent.publish.ThriftAuthenti
cationClient - Transport...
594 просмотров
schedule
11.03.2022
использование бережливости в js, не полагаясь на бережливость RPC
В настоящее время я работаю над проектом, для которого требуется множество платформ, использующих множество языков программирования (включая js) для связи с сервером Java.
В настоящее время протокол использует бережливость для сериализации данных...
728 просмотров
schedule
11.06.2022
Cassandra CLI 'org.apache.thrift.transport.TTransportException'
У меня последняя версия Cassandra 1.1.2, и у меня уже есть данные в моей базе данных Cassandra. Я хочу обновить метаданные семейства столбцов через:
обновить семейство столбцов Комментарий с column_metadata = [{column_name: timestamp,...
1158 просмотров
schedule
07.09.2023